Transaction 0566736f0113c7edbb18b62a50983e2e134c4ad7bc07781d4ef2c4cb90aae37c

1 Input
2 Outputs
  • 0566736f0113c7edbb18b62a50983e2e134c4ad7bc07781d4ef2c4cb90aae37c:0
  • value  220500
    address  3Fo6mXScPD9rYiq1DsxQ9DDRjCRA2opk1h
  • 0566736f0113c7edbb18b62a50983e2e134c4ad7bc07781d4ef2c4cb90aae37c:1
  • value  94146648
    address  39FjfyKTS8EEfEifKGe31dkZ9whwdMnV9D